#DA347A Hex Color Code

#DA347A

The Hexadecimal Color #DA347A is a contrast shade of Medium Violet Red. #DA347A RGB value is rgb(218, 52, 122). RGB Color Model of #DA347A consists of 85% red, 20% green and 47% blue. HSL color Mode of #DA347A has 335°(degrees) Hue, 69% Saturation and 53% Lightness. #DA347A color has an wavelength of 409.07407n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#DA347A is #FF6699.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#DA347A is #D37. The Closest Color to #DA347A is #C71585. Official Name of #DA347A Hex Code is Cerise Red.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#DA347A is 0 Cyan 76 Magenta 44 Yellow 15 Black and #DA347A CMY is 0, 76, 44.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#DA347A is hsl(335,69,53,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(335, 76, 85).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#DA347A is 33.66, 18.77, 20.26.
Hex8 Value of #DA347A is #DA347AFF. Decimal Value of #DA347A is 14300282 and Octal Value of #DA347A is 66432172. Binary Value of #DA347A is 11011010, 110100, 1111010 and Android of #DA347A is 4292490362 / 0xffda347a.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#DA347A is 0.463, 0.258, 0.258 and YIQ Color Space of #DA347A is 109.614, 76.4284, 56.893.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#DA347A is 29.44, 8.3, 20.28.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#DA347A is 50.42, 67.47, 0.33.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#DA347A is 50.42, 105.03, -12.49.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#DA347A is 50.42, 67.47, 0.28. Hunter Lab variable of #DA347A is 43.32, 62.86, 2.6.

Various Color Shades of #DA347A

To get 25% Saturated #DA347A Color, you need to convert the hex color #DA347A to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#DA347A h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#DA347A

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
